Mesothelioma Attorneys

A mesothelioma lawyer can help you make a personal injury claim, wrongful death suit or asbestos trust fund claim. They will also work to discover which asbestos companies are responsible for your exposure.

Because mesothelioma has a long latency period, it may be difficult to remember where or when you were exposed to asbestos. A mesothelioma attorney will use specific resources to locate the facts.

Cases that go to trial

Mesothelioma lawsuits can be complex however, a majority of claims reach settlement agreements before going to trial. However, if a case does go to trial, a jury will determine how much compensation the victim is entitled to. A verdict at trial can be appealed and may delay any compensation payments for months or even years.

In the United States, the majority of mesothelioma lawsuits are filed by personal injury lawyers. They seek financial compensation to cover medical bills, lost wages and other costs. Compensation from a mesothelioma lawsuit will not restore health or bring back the life of a loved one, but it can help the victims and their families get the best treatment possible.

The discovery phase can last for months while lawyers gather evidence and speak with witnesses. A mesothelioma lawyer will interview former and current workers who could provide valuable information regarding asbestos exposure. The lawyer will also gather medical documents to prove that asbestos exposure resulted in a mesothelioma diagnosis. At this point the client could be asked to take depositions that are recorded and played to a jury in the case of a trial.

The lawsuits for wrongful death seek compensation for a family member's death due to mesothelioma or another asbestos-related disease. These lawsuits seek justice by holding accountable parties accountable for exposed victims to asbestos. These lawsuits are filed by the spouses, children, or other dependents who have lost loved ones.

A mesothelioma lawyer may also assist victims to determine the amount of compensation they're entitled to receive. Compensation in a mesothelioma case could include non-economic, economic and punitive damages. Economic damages include the future and past medical expenses as well as lost wages and funeral expenses. Non-economic damages can include pain and discomfort, loss of consortium and emotional distress.
